Be careful of this accomodation.
I made a booking back in April for 1st October for one night. I pre-paid €107 in advance as required and paid by Paypal. However, due to a change of plan (and camino) I emailed the property on 6th July to cancel my booking and to request a refund. The booking confirmation clearly states that cancellation without charge is only possible if cancelled at least 60 days before arrival date. No response. I chased again by email. No reply.
As I had paid by Paypal I raised a dispute. Again no response. I escalated the claim a couple of days ago and again no response. Paypal requires a seller response by 24th July. I decided to be proactive and rang the property. After explaining who I was and why I was calling and asking when I was going to be refunded, the man hung up. I tried to call back in case the line had accidentally been interrupted (ever the optimist) but it went unanswered. I can now reasonably conclude that the property is deliberately refusing to refund me.
€107 is not a trifling sum and I was requesting cancellation within the terms and conditions of the booking.
I hope Paypal will take action of their own and proceed to refund me after the 24th July.
